Ealing Broadway station is adeptly equipped to handle the daily throng of passengers, offering a range of facilities to enhance the commuter experience. The station boasts ticket offices open from early morning until late at night, ensuring you can purchase and collect your rail tickets with ease. For those who prefer the convenience of technology, ticket machines are accessible and intuitive, even for individuals with any mobility or sensory needs. The station is designed with inclusivity in mind, reflected in its step-free access and staff assistance throughout.
Customer service is a priority at Ealing Broadway. A dedicated help point and proactive ticket office staff ensure you have all the guidance you need. Concerns about luggage? While there's no baggage storage, the ever-watchful CCTV secures your peace of mind as you journey through. Toilets and baby changing facilities are easily accessible on the concourse, making it a family-friendly stop for travelers of all ages.
Beyond the tracks, Ealing Broadway provides seamless connectivity to multiple forms of transportation. You can easily hop on a Transport for London bus right outside the station or slide into the tunnels of the London Underground via the Central and District Lines. For those jetting off to further destinations, the Elizabeth Line offers a direct route to Heathrow Airport, simplifying your travel plans.
Want to explore the city on two wheels? Bicycle hire services such as Brompton Dock are conveniently available, ensuring that you enjoy your journey sustainably. Although there are no bicycle storage spaces or sheltered parking at the station, cycling enthusiasts will find ample ways to navigate the cityscape.

If you find yourself at Ynyswen Train Station, you’ll notice the station operates without an onsite ticket office. Fret not, as ticket machines are available to collect pre-purchased tickets. These user-friendly machines ensure that you can retrieve your tickets seamlessly—even if you forgot to buy them in advance. A focus on accessibility is evident, with induction loops installed and ticket machines ready to accommodate those with additional needs. Remember to bring a debit or credit card, as the machines are cashless.
While the station doesn’t boast a full range of facilities, essential information is displayed on departure and arrival screens, and announcements keep travelers informed. Although there are no waiting rooms, rest assured a seating area provides comfort while you await your train. If you're in need of assistance, help is never far away. You can access support by calling the helpline at 0800 200 6060.
Linking seamlessly with local transport options, Ynyswen Station serves as a convenient starting point for broader travels. While the station does not provide accessible taxis or parking spaces, a rail replacement service operates at a local bus stop nearby. When circumstances such as rail maintenance arise, this service is invaluable for keeping your journey on track. Located conveniently near Cuts and Curls, this stop ensures you can transition smoothly between train and bus services.
